DLAA is also entirely different from DLSS 3.0, it‘s the DLSS algorithm applied to the native image, whereas the other is Framegen.

You seem to be a confused, DLSS is an upscaler, it’s not framegen, they are 2 entirely separate things, DLSS doesn’t add latency, framegen does.
You can use DLSS and DLAA without using framegen.
I agree with asking for official DLAA support (which I’d also like to see, that’s how I ended up in this thread), which is not DLSS, it’s in the name, Deep Learning Anti Aliasing vs Deep Learning Super Sampling.
As such DLAA isn’t “entirely different” it’s almost entirely the same thing, just using a different input resolution (the only part you had right), that’s literally the only difference.

It depends on how you look at it. Up scaling the rendered image takes time, so technically additional latency. However, if rendering a 1080P image takes 15ms, and rendering a 720P image takes 10ms, and up scaling the 720P to 1080P takes an additional 2ms, then it technically reduces latency.

DLSS does add “display” latency, which I can’t quantify due to upscaling delay to generate per frame basis. DLAA has it’s own delay of processing time before presenting each frame.

However if not capping FPS and DLSS increases your frame rate then it reduces input latency. This is why esports players never cap their frame rate and let it run past the limit of their monitor refresh rate and put all graphics to lowest. So even if you have 60Hz monitor, running 120FPS gives no visual difference, but there is input latency benefit.

But really the display latency cost is of smaller margin and compensated by more decrease of input latency leading to “overall” lower total latency given good FPS gains of using it.

Frame Generation

Look at what happens if you cap your FPS and use FG. The higher the MFG x2, x3 etc setting the higher it increases input latency because you’re forcing the game to render at lower “native” frame rate each time.

The graph suggests to uncap your frame to maintain lower input latency true. But visually jarringespecially Darktide with FPS dips up and down without consistently. Also random mismatch of FPS vs mouse responsiveness

FG - Good for slow adventure games. Not good for fast paced games requiring fast response and reactions in game

So they’re opposite. DLSS increases frame rate past the cost of display latency of upscaling then it decreases input latency. But FG, turn it on and cap say 120 FPS and start using MFG x2 onwards etc then your input latency increases because you’re forcing lower native FPS.
